Retrospective Study of the Biomechanical Properties of Large Allografts
NCT00632294 · Status: TERMINATED · Type: OBSERVATIONAL · Enrollment: 2
Last updated 2012-08-01
Summary
Primary Objectives:
1. To evaluate the material properties, histomorphometric indices, bone mineral density (BMD), and presence of microfractures in retrieved large allograft cortical bone specimens removed from orthopaedic oncology patients.
2. To correlate physical properties to patient demographics and medical treatment received.
